The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ers needs a small business to supply plastic materials for its facilities over five years.
Key Details
The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Engineer Research and Development Center (ERDC), needs a small business to supply plastic materials for its facilities over the next five years. The Blanket Purchase Agreement (BPA) will be firm-fixed price, with no minimum guarantee or minimum BPA Call value. The Government estimates the total volume of purchases will total $5,000,000.00, but there is no guarantee.
- What's the contract structure and timeline?
The BPA will expire in five years or when the not-to-exceed limit of $5,000,000.00 is reached, whichever is earlier. The Government anticipates awarding 3-5 Blanket Purchase Agreements based on evaluation factors.
- How will they pick the winner?
The Government will evaluate quotations based on best value, with no minimum guarantee of work.
- When and how do you bid?
Quotes are due on July 20, 2026, and must be submitted electronically through the SAM website.
Who can apply
- Any certified small business may apply.
